HB 1340 Summary

  • Amends the definition of "Offender" in the Delayed Sentencing Program for Young Adults under 22 O.S. 2011, Section 996.1

  • Expands eligibility to include individuals ages 18-21 or juveniles certified to stand trial as adults convicted of nonviolent felonies

  • Adds unlawful manufacturing, attempted unlawful manufacturing, and aggravated manufacturing of controlled dangerous substances and violations of the Trafficking in Illegal Drugs Act to the list of disqualifying offenses

  • Adds discharging any firearm or deadly weapon at or into any dwelling as a disqualifying offense for program participation

  • Becomes effective November 1, 2013
